On June 6, 2015, school bus drivers will compete in the annual School Bus ‘Roadeo’ which will be held in High River this year, and will have various components designed to motivate and reinforce skills, bring public awareness, recognize excellence, and encourage communication.
Based on international NSTA rules and regulations, drivers will be judged on their professionalism through a series of challenges that includes a written test based on provincial standards, commercial vehicle inspections, and driving skills that will include parallel parking, student loading, and offset or diminishing lanes.
The contest is a fun way to challenge one’s self and others in the profession, as well as to meet fellow school bus drivers in the region. At the end of the contest a dinner is enjoyed by all and achievement awards are handed out. Six of the contestants will be eligible to compete at the international level.
The Whitecourt team will consist of Lisa Arnell, Deana Halhead, Jeff Smith, and manager Barb Walsh.
